Domaine de Frégate

Located on the Mediterranean Sea between the towns of St Cyr/Mer in Bandol, Domaine de Frégate is exposed to the south and west, ensuring an ideal climate for regular and complete maturation of its grapes. The 30-hectare estate is planted on clay and calcareous soils that are dry and rocky. The result is a harmonious wine that is characteristically bold but maintains a mild finish. The varieties of grapes used are Mourvèdre, Grenache and Cinsault giving both the red and rosé wines the characteristics very typical of the Bandol appellation.


 

Domaine de Frégate Bandol Rosé

Appellation: Bandol
Grapes: Mourvedre, Grenache, Cinsault
Alcohol: 12.5% vol.
Appearance: Pale
Nose: White floral notes
Palate: Soft and fruity and at the same time still very dry.
Pairing: It is perfect to serve with grilled meat and fish. It is also very popular as an aperitif and with the specialties of the region.

Domaine de Frégate Bandol Rouge

Appellation: Bandol
Grapes: 65% Mourvedre, Grenache, Cinsault
Vinification: Aged 18 months in oak barrels
Alcohol: 13.5% vol.
Appearance: Rich ruby in color
Nose: Aromas of violet, raspberry, mulberry, truffle and undergrowth.
Palate: Strong wine. Stays balanced & elegant. The Mourvedre grapes makes this an original wine. With an aroma that’s very unique, it rests on the palate for some time.
Pairings: It is a perfect match for wild game, meat with sauces and of course cheese.
